About Semac Construction Limited
Semac Construction Limited provides integrated design, engineering, procurement, construction, and consultancy services for commercial and industrial projects in India. The company engages in the business of engineering and procurement contractors, general engineers, mechanical engineers, process engineers, civil engineers, general mechanical and civil contractors, architectural structural, mechanical, electrical, plumbing, and fire suppression, as well as offers project management services. It also constructs, builds, develops, maintains, operates, owns, and transfers infrastructure facilities, including housing, roads, highways, bridges, airports, ports, rail systems, water supply projects, irrigation projects, water treatment systems, solid waste management systems, inland water ways and ports, and allied activities. The company was formerly known as Semac Consultants Limited and changed its name to Semac Construction Limited in May 2025. Semac Construction Limited was incorporated in 1962 and is headquartered in Gurugram, India.
